Find results that contain all of your keywords. Content filter is on. Search will return best illustrations, stock vectors and clipart.
Make it so!
You have chosen to exclude "" from your results.

Choose orientation:

The Body Shop Strore In London Editorial Image


The Body Shop strore in London Editorial Stock Photo
Designed by
Title
The Body Shop strore in London #149215348
Description

The Body Shop International Limited, trading as The Body Shop, is a British cosmetics, skin care and perfume company that was founded in 1976 in Brighton, UK by Dame Anita Roddick. It currently has a range of 1,000 products which it sells in about 3,000 owned and franchised stores internationally in more than 65 countries.

This image is editorial